Notes: Scarce - the BL only on JiscHub, though also present at Bodley; the novel was reprinted a couple of times in the following few decades, and recently brought back into print by the Swan River Press. A tale of diabolic possession - engaging with both historical ideas of witchcraft and contemporary political events - in which Jenny Flower, a London slum-child, encounters a 'Dark Stranger'. It was banned on publication in Ireland. Mannin was a prolific author, whose relationships with Bertrand Russell and W.B.
